Ratio Explanation:

The ratio reflects the balance between the transport of ergothioneine (via SLC22A4) and carnitine intermediates (related to SLC22A5 function), which are both involved in cellular transport.

Ratio Evidence:

metabolites related through biology

Gene Ratio Phenotype Relationship:

Genetic variants in SLC22A4/SLC22A5, which are colocalized eQTLs, likely alter the transport of their respective substrates, ergothioneine and carnitine derivatives. This altered transport may influence inflammatory and metabolic processes, leading to changes in hematological parameters like neutrophil and lymphocyte counts.22[1], 23[2], 24[3], 25[4], 26[5], 27[6], 28[7]
